
Introduction
Taiwan’s climate poses a challenge for cyclists: afternoon thunderstorms in the mountains are almost a daily occurrence in summer, while winter’s northeast monsoon in the north carries a fine drizzle, making every ride plan require consideration of “what if it rains.” A good cycling waterproof jacket or rain jacket lets you keep riding through unexpected rainfall, rather than scrambling for shelter in a convenience store to wait out the rain.
Understanding Waterproof Performance Metrics
Before choosing a waterproof jacket, you need to understand two key metrics:
Water Column (mm)
Indicates how high a column of water the fabric can withstand without leaking.
- 1,000–3,000mm: Basic water resistance; fine for brief light rain, but quickly soaks through in heavy downpours
- 5,000–10,000mm: Moderate waterproofing; suitable for typical rainfall
- 10,000–20,000mm: Good waterproofing; suitable for extended riding in the rain
- 20,000mm and above: Top-tier waterproofing; professional race grade
Moisture Vapor Transmission Rate (MVTR, g/m²/24hr)
Indicates how many grams of water vapor (i.e., your sweat) the fabric can expel per square meter per day.
- Below 5,000: Stuff; suitable for short, occasional use
- 10,000–15,000: Average; acceptable for light activity
- 15,000–25,000: Good; suitable for cycling-intensity riding
- Above 25,000: Excellent; won’t feel stuffy even during high-intensity exercise
| Jacket Type | Water Column | MVTR | Best Use Case |
|---|---|---|---|
| Basic lightweight windbreaker | None/1,000 | High | Wind protection, light drizzle |
| Mid-range rain jacket | 5,000–10,000 | 10,000–15,000 | Afternoon thunderstorms |
| High-end Gore-Tex jacket | 20,000+ | 25,000+ | All-weather riding in the rain |
| Reversible poncho-style rain cape | 8,000–15,000 | Low | Emergency backup; not recommended for riding |
Special Considerations for Taiwan’s Climate
Summer Afternoon Thunderstorms in the Mountains
Summer convective rain in Taiwan’s mountains is characterized by: arriving quickly, heavy downpours, and short duration (usually 15–30 minutes). In this scenario, the most important factors are not top-tier waterproofing, but:
- Small packed size: Must fit into a jersey rear pocket
- Quick to deploy and put on: Only 5 minutes of lead time before the downpour hits
- Basic waterproofing is sufficient: Rain is heavy but brief; 8,000–10,000mm water column is usually enough
Recommended: Gore Wear C5 GTX Shakedry (ultra-lightweight, 140g), or Castelli Tempesta Race Rain Jacket (available through Taiwan distributors).
Winter Northeast Monsoon in the North
The “drizzle” of northern Taiwan’s winter is the trickiest to handle—the rain isn’t heavy, but it persists for a long time, and temperatures are low (10–15°C). This scenario calls for a “waterproof + windproof + insulated” three-in-one function, while maintaining moisture-wicking capability over extended rides.
Recommended: Gore C3 GTX Infinium™, Rapha Pro Team Gore-Tex Jacket (lightweight with high waterproofing).
Lightweight Rain Jacket Comparison
Ultra-Lightweight Emergency Type (100–200g, NT$3,000–6,000)
- Primary purpose: Emergency rain protection; fits into a jersey pocket
- Representative models: Proviz Reflect 360 Ultralight Rain Jacket, Decathlon Triban RC900
- Drawbacks: Limited breathability; you’ll still soak through from the inside during high-intensity riding
Mid-Range Multi-Purpose Type (200–350g, NT$6,000–12,000)
- Balances waterproofing and breathability
- Representative models: Gore Wear C5 GTX Active, Shimano Windbreak Rain Jacket
- Suitable for 80% of Taiwan cyclists’ needs
Top-Tier All-Weather Type (150–300g, NT$12,000–25,000)
- Top-grade membranes such as Gore-Tex or Shakedry, combining extreme waterproofing with high breathability
- Representative models: Gore Wear C5 GTX Shakedry, Assos Trail Spring Fall HD Jacket
- Suitable for racing or long-distance all-day riding
Windbreakers: Great Companions for Non-Rainy Days
Wind speeds on Taiwan’s mountain descents can reach 30–50km/h; even on clear days, descending from Wuling or Hehuan Mountain requires wind protection and warmth. A lightweight windbreaker fills the gap for “no rain expected but wind protection needed.”
Key buying considerations:
- Weight < 100g: Foldable to fit into a jersey pocket
- DWR water-repellent treatment: To handle light drizzle
- Extended rear hem: Accommodates the forward-leaning cycling position, preventing exposed lower back
Recommended: Castelli Gabba 3 (two-in-one windproof and waterproof), Giro Chrono Expert Wind Jacket
Practical Tips
- Check rear pocket depth: The rain jacket must fit into your jersey’s rear pockets; measure pocket depth (usually 15–18cm)
- Back vent zipper design: Jackets with rear moisture-wicking vents significantly improve comfort on long rides
- Reflective details are a plus: Visibility is low in the rain; reflective materials on the jacket enhance safety
- Don’t buy a “rainy-day” general-purpose rain poncho: Convenience store rain ponchos get blown up by the wind, are dangerous, and are simply unsuitable for cycling
- Regularly renew DWR water-repellent treatment: DWR gradually wears off after use; use a water-repellent spray to restore it
Conclusion
Taiwan’s climate has turned cycling rain jackets from an optional accessory into essential gear. A lightweight rain jacket that fits into a jersey pocket, offers waterproofing of 8,000mm or above, and weighs under 200g is basic equipment for every Taiwanese road cyclist. Choose the appropriate performance tier based on your primary riding scenarios—summer mountain rides, northern winter conditions, or long-distance touring—so bad weather no longer becomes a reason to cancel your ride plans.
